What is a solar photovoltaic (PV) panel?
A solar photovoltaic (PV) panel is a device that can convert solar energy directly to electricity. However, thermal energy accumulating in PV panels inevitably results in the increase of its temperature, leading to the decrease of PV’s efficiency, which is already low. Combining PV panel with the hot side of TEG could enhance the PV’s power output.

How does a photovoltaic system work?
A photovoltaic system is designed to generate and supply electricity from solar radiant energy using solar panel. Solar panels absorb the solar radiant energy and convert it into electricity. An inverter is also connected to convert DC power to AC.

How do I design a solar PV system?
Step 1: Assess Your Solar PotentialThe first step in designing a solar PV system is to evaluate the solar potential of your property. This includes analyzing geographical location, climate, and the orientation and tilt of the solar panels.
